Senior Azure Cloud Administrator to establish and maintain various PaaS, IaaS Azure resources, resource groups & subscriptions aligning with Azure Landing
S.i. Systems
Ottawa, ON-
Number of positions available : 1
- Salary To be discussed
-
Contract job
- Published on September 23rd, 2025
-
Starting date : 1 position to fill as soon as possible
Description
Contract: 1 year
10 days a month on-site in Ottawa
Must Haves
• University degree in Computer Science, Information Technology, or related field
• Minimum of five (5) years of experience in Microsoft Azure and or Cloud engineering roles
• Minimum of five (5) years of experience with Azure core services (Compute, Storage, Networking, AAD, RBAC, Serverless, Containers)
• Demonstrated experience working in Agile teams using JIRA and documenting in Confluence
• Demonstrated experience with hybrid environments (on-premises + cloud integration)
• Demonstrated understanding of virtualization technologies (VMware, Hyper-V) and migration practices
• Demonstrated experience in setting up and maintaining CI/CD pipelines using Azure DevOps, ArgoCD GitOps
• Demonstrated understanding with Git-based version control systems like GitHub
• Demonstrated ability to work autonomously, self-prioritizing, switching between multiple tasks as required, to deliver high-priority items quickly
Nice to haves:
• Microsoft Azure certifications such as Azure Administrator Associate (AZ-104) or Azure Solutions Architect
• Demonstrated knowledge of IaaS, PaaS, SaaS Azure services (Secret management, Databases, Backup management, API management, image repositories etc.)
• Demonstrated experience with Azure security tools (Security Center, Defender for Cloud)
• Demonstrated experience with scripting and automation (PowerShell, Azure CLI, ARM templates, Bicep, Terraform)
• Demonstrated experience with Azure networking (VNets, VPNs, ExpressRoute, NSGs, load balancers)
• Demonstrated knowledge of identity management (Azure AD, SSO, MFA, conditional access)
• Demonstrated knowledge with containerization and orchestration (ARO, Kubernetes, AKS)
• Demonstrated experience with monitoring and logging tools (Azure Monitor, Log Analytics, Application Insights)
• Demonstrated experience in backup and disaster recovery solutions (Azure Backup, Site Recovery)
• Demonstrated understanding of DevOps practices (CI/CD pipelines, GitHub Actions, Azure DevOps)
Responsibilities:
Under the direction of the Assistant Director, Cloud and Virtualization Services;
• Establish and maintain various PaaS, IaaS Azure resources, resource groups & subscriptions aligning with Azure Landing Zone framework
• Deploy, configure, and maintain Azure services like storage accounts, recovery service vaults, ketvault, login apps, function apps, etc., including sku selection, private endpoints and optimizing for workload performance
• Set up and maintain most of the PaaS Azure services, ensuring data redundancy, lifecycle policies, and secure access and network controls • Support workload migration from on-premises or other clouds to Azure, ensuring minimal downtime and smooth transition
• Track and evaluate resource utilization, system performance, making pro-active recommendations for optimization
• Configure and maintain Azure networking components such as VNets, subnets, NSGs, route tables and private DNS zones
• Apply and enforce governance standards using Azure Policy, management groups, and compliance monitoring tools
• Automate routine tasks with Azure Automation, PowerShell, CLI scripts, and Infrastructure as Code (IaC) templates
• Collaborate with developers and DevOps teams to support CI/CD pipelines and streamline application deployments
• Troubleshoot connectivity, configuration, and performance issues across Azure services, networks, and resources
• Optimize cloud resources and spending by rightsizing services, reserving instances, and and implementing costoptimization strategy
• Monitor logs, metrics, and alerts through Azure Monitor, Log Analytics, Dynatrace and Application Insights for proactive issue detection
• Implement and maintain role-based access control (RBAC) to enforce least-privilege access and prevent unauthorized activity
• Configure and maintain Azure RedHat OpenShift (ARO) clusters, image registries, GitOps tools and container instances, ensuring availability and scaling
• Work with internal stakeholders and subject matter experts to meet project goals and best practices
Requirements
undetermined
undetermined
undetermined
undetermined
Other S.i. Systems's offers that may interest you